Youll leave this class with a practical checklist that you can use to counsel clients on entity choices. And well discuss a very recent IRS release that helps clarify self-employment tax in the context of LLCs.

Almost all CPAs encounter the following question from clients: What type of entity should my business be? This course will help answer that question well use real-world strategies that will assist you in helping clients reduce their tax liabilities by proper selection of the best entity for the particular situation. Well cover the revised landscape after the enactment of the Tax Cuts and Jobs Act of 2017.

Major Topics:
- "Check the box rules"
- Should clients convert from S corporation status to C corporations?
- How the new 20% 199A deduction affected choice of entity for federal tax purposes.
- C corp, S corp and partnership tax rules
- Partnerships vs. S corps: Contribution of property and services; allocation of income; transfer of ownership interests; redemptions, liquidations and owners retiring; and owner compensation/self-employed income and other benefits
- Minimizing payroll taxes in the context of preserving social security benefits.
